Prepares visual presentations by designing art and copy layouts. Plans, analyzes, and creates original visual solutions to communications projects. Identifies the most effective way to get messages across in print and electronic media using color, type, illustration, photography, animation, and various print and layout techniques. Develops the overall layout and production design of magazines, newspapers, journals, corporate reports, and other publications. Uses perspective, isometric, orthographic, and schematic techniques to prepare technical and non-technical illustrations and line drawings for slide presentations, view graphics, reports, brochures, etc. Produces promotional displays, packaging, and marketing brochures for products and services, designs distinctive logos for products and businesses, and develop signs and signage systems for business and government. Develops material for Internet Web pages, interactive media, and multimedia projects. Gathers relevant information by meeting with clients, creative or art directors, and by performing own research. Prepares sketches or layouts—by hand or with the aid of a computer—to illustrate vision for the design.
